Katie Rost is leaving The Real Housewives of Potomac, the mom and model announced. “Sad to announce I will not be on #RHOP this season:-( Can’t make my life exciting enough. #DeliveredTomorrow,” she tweeted on Thursday.

Katie joined the show in its debut season, alongside, Gizelle Bryant, Ashley Darby, Robyn Dixon, Karen Huger and Charrisse Jackson Jordan. The status of the rest of the cast remains up in the air with production on season two currently underway.

Before the show debuted in January 2016, Bravo teased that it was “the show you never saw coming, and it’s going to take everyone by surprise.”

In season one, Katie clashed with Gizelle Bryant. The costars argued over race identity and questionable behavior exhibited by Katie throughout the season. Gizelle accused the mother of three of using drugs and slammed her parenting, “If you are concerned about your children’s custody then don’t get on tv drunk and high,” Gizelle tweeted in April.

RHOP is one of two new additions to the ‘Real Housewives’ franchise. The first season of RHOP averaged 2.1 million viewers, making it the network’s highest-rated freshman series since The Real Housewives of Beverly Hills when it comes to total viewers. RHOP also averaged 1.3 million viewers (in P25-54) and 1.2 million (in P18-49), which is Bravo’s highest-rated new series since Vanderpump Rules.
